Triple booting, OS's installed in this order
XP 160G drive
Vista 320G drive
Win7 80G partition from the 320G drive

Best way to remove 80G partition and restore my boot mgr for XP and Vista?

If Vista is marked "system" in Disk Management, you just need to format the W7 partition from Vista and remove the W7 entry from the BCD.
If W7 is "system", you'll first need to use EasyBCD 2.0 latest build / diagnostics / change boot drive, to copy the boot files to Vista, then do the above.
